CWT Hedge Fund Activity: Q3 2020 in Review

248 of the 4,970 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in California Water Service (CWT) for Q3 2020, worth a combined $1.62B — down 6.5% from $1.73B a quarter earlier.

Sellers outnumbered buyers: 31 funds closed out of CWT and 22 opened new positions — a net loss of 9 holders — while 79 trimmed existing stakes and 83 added.

The largest buyer was Impax Asset Management Group, adding an estimated $38.2M. The largest seller was Allianz Asset Management, cutting an estimated $16.4M.
